Abstract

The problem of discreteness—continuity of sensory space, and as a consequence—of psychological space is considered. Different models used in psychophysics, different interpretation of the threshold problem in psychology, as well as different threshold theories lead to ambiguous understanding of this problem. Our model of psychological measurement is based on the concept of “generalized image” (GI). By definition, GI is a dynamic system that is in a continuous process of self-formation. This process can be represented as a continuous series of acts of comparison of the predicted state of the GI with the current one. As a result of such acts of comparison, a certain “measuring space” arises, in which further forecast of the state of the GI is carried out. Each stimulus set corresponds to a certain stable set of subjective characteristics (the main characteristics of the mental image of the stimulus set), which basically determine the psychological assessment of the stimulus. We call this stable set of subjective characteristics the quasi-objective scale. In the process of measurement, incentives are distributed along this scale in accordance with the degree of representation in them of certain subjective characteristics.
